Service

Monitor batteries

The battery-powered devices (room unit, room temperature sensor, meteo
sensor, radiator control actuator, door / window contact and smoke detector)
constantly monitor their batteries' capacity. If batteries are low, a message is
forwarded to the central apartment unit.
In that case, the central apartment unit switches from the quiescent picture to
info page "Device state" to show the device with the exhausted batteries
(provided there is no more severe fault). After a certain period of time, the
display will return to the quiescent picture and show the error symbol
On the battery-powered devices themselves – with the exception of the room
unit, the door / window contact and the smoke detector – the result of auto-
matic battery monitoring is not displayed.

Room unit QAW910

The room unit indicates when its batteries are close to exhaustion.

Door / window contact wave AP 260

If batteries must be replaced, the LED will briefly flash every 10 seconds.

DELTA reflex smoke detector

If batteries must be replaced, the LED will briefly flash 3 times every 48 sec-
onds and a short acoustic signal is given.

Manual capacity check

With the room temperature sensor, the meteo sensor and the radiator control
actuator, battery capacity is also checked when a binding test is made (refer
to page 90).
If, during the binding test, the green LED of the respective device is lit, battery
capacity is sufficient.
If, during the binding test, the red LED of the respective device is lit or is dark,
battery capacity is insufficient.

If the batteries are exhausted in
about 3 months' time, the "low" sym-
bol is displayed.
